Christ, Our Passover
Henry L. Gilmour • English
Primary Scripture: 1 Corinthians 5:7
Verse 1
Our Lamb is slain, the Paschal Lamb, Of which the old is but a token; Tho’ shadowed in the midnight past, There’s not a word has e’er been broken.
Chorus
I’m under the blood, the passover blood, The Lam was “slain from the foundation:” It points to the side of Jesus, who died, And purchased for us salvation.
Verse 2
Come, climb to Calv’ry’s mournful site, And see the streaming wounds of Jesus; The spotless victim yields his life, And from the sword of justice frees us.
Chorus
I’m under the blood, the passover blood, The Lam was “slain from the foundation:” It points to the side of Jesus, who died, And purchased for us salvation.
Verse 3
I’ll ne’er forget when first, by faith, I saw my Saviour, bleeding, dying; And there again, for Perfect Love, I plunged into the fountain, crying.
Chorus
I’m under the blood, the passover blood, The Lam was “slain from the foundation:” It points to the side of Jesus, who died, And purchased for us salvation.
Verse 4
There’s sweet repose beneath the cross, And safety when the blood doth cover; For God has spoken in his word, “When I see the blood, I will pass over.”
Chorus
I’m under the blood, the passover blood, The Lam was “slain from the foundation:” It points to the side of Jesus, who died, And purchased for us salvation.
Verse 5
The blood’s the bridge that spans the gulf, And brings us near to God, and Heaven; It flows for you, it flows for me, O sinner, come, ’tis freely given.
Chorus
I’m under the blood, the passover blood, The Lam was “slain from the foundation:” It points to the side of Jesus, who died, And purchased for us salvation.
